What companies run services between Hatton Cross Underground Station, England and The Shard, England?

London Underground (Tube) operates a subway from Hatton Cross station to Green Park station every 5 minutes. Tickets cost £12–50 and the journey takes 43 min. Alternatively, Metrobus operates a bus from Hatton Cross Station to East Croydon Rail Station every 10 minutes, and the journey takes 1h 37m.
